WebApr 1, 2024 · Chitin nanofibrils can be extracted from native chitin using a combination of mechanical and acid treatments ( Ifuku, 2014 ). Chitin nanofibrils (ChNFs) have been shown to adsorb to oil-water interfaces and form oil-in-water Pickering emulsions ( Tzoumaki, Moschakis, Kiosseoglou, & Biliaderis, 2011; Zhou et al., 2024c ).
